100% scam. Ordered, paid, order status was placed 'On hold' with no communication. Finally contacted them asking what's up, they come back saying the system miscalculated sales tax and needed an additional 85€, when Czech VAT is 21% so it should've been 47.25€ total. Asked to please refund the purchase. They responded that they'd lower VAT to 70€. They didn't even provide how much bitcoin it'd be as I'm assuming that'd lead into yet another exchange where "oops, you sent the wrong amount, it's actually <amount> more."  Their response: 0.011 BTC (83.21€ equivalent), but if I sent 0.019 BTC (143.72€ equivalent) they'd throw in a Trezor wallet with Cryptosteel which would be an insane discount. Too insane.

Again asked for refund and gave address where to send it. Never heard from them again...

I'm posting this as it's one of the first Google results when searching for whether or not cryptobitspot.com is a scam. There are enough fake reviews and employee's smurf accounts trying to make people believe they're legit that it was hard to know. Wanted to confirm to other people that they should stay away.   

*NOTE to people coming here from Google: users jungmining and michaelharmsen are known scammers/shills on this forum. Ignore their comments. Saying if tax is owed then just pay it might sound right, but that's assuming the tax is real or that you'll ever receive what you ordered.

no scam at all i have translated his text and he is complaining about taxes.... i think everyone should pay them if required.

Their con is that no matter what you order they come back telling the customer a fake amount of VAT was "accidentally not included," try to haggle VAT if you actually question them, etc. They string people along to pay just a bit more just a bit more just a bit more until finally the person wants a refund, then they stop talking to you.
